What the Pipeline for Case Western Reserve University Shows

According to the ClinicalTrials.gov registry, Case Western Reserve University is linked to 141 US clinical trials across every stage of research activity. Of those, 23 studies are currently recruiting, about 16% of the sponsor's indexed portfolio, and 100 are already marked complete, representing roughly 71% of the total.

The phase mix for Case Western Reserve University reports 6 late-stage studies (Phase 3 and Phase 4 combined) and 10 earlier-phase studies (Phase 1 and Phase 2).

The top therapeutic focus area indexed for Case Western Reserve University is Bipolar Disorder with 6 linked trials, and 9 other condition areas appear in the top list above.

How to read these pipeline numbers

Recruiting share is one of the more practical signals here: it reflects how much of a sponsor's research is presently open to new participants, while the completed share indicates the depth of finished work that has already contributed registry results. Both counts come directly from the public ClinicalTrials.gov dataset and are refreshed on the registry side; this page mirrors the latest data pull without altering it.

A portfolio weighted toward Phase 3 usually reflects an organization advancing candidates toward regulatory review, where the research centers on comparative efficacy and broader safety across larger populations. A heavier Phase 1 and Phase 2 tilt generally indicates exploratory work, safety, dosing, and early signal detection, and is common among research-forward sponsors that seed many early programs. Phase 4 entries, when present, track interventions already in real-world use and typically focus on long-term safety, effectiveness across subgroups, or formulation comparisons.

That distribution is a quick read of where the organization concentrates its research attention; it does not imply product availability, market share, or any clinical endorsement.
